Chery Omoda E5 vs Suzuki Swift Sport

Verdict

The Chery Omoda E5 asks RM15,900 more, but its 61 kWh battery and 430 km WLTP range make it the more practical daily Malaysian car if home or workplace charging is available. Its 201 hp motor also reaches 100 km/h in 7.2 seconds, ahead of the Swift Sport’s 140 hp, 8.0-second petrol setup. The Suzuki counters with a 205 km/h top speed, lower RM70 annual road tax and a much smaller 970 kg footprint. Choose based on charging access and space needs, not badge loyalty.

Omoda E5

Pick the Chery Omoda E5 if you can charge regularly and want 430 km of WLTP range, a 378-litre boot and more active-safety equipment.

Swift Sport

Pick the Suzuki Swift Sport if you want the lower RM70 annual road tax, a 205 km/h top speed and a compact 3,890 mm hatchback.

Key differences

  • Price: Chery Omoda E5 RM146,800; Suzuki Swift Sport RM130,900.
  • Power and torque: Chery Omoda E5 201 hp and 340 Nm; Suzuki Swift Sport 140 hp and 230 Nm.
  • 0-100 km/h: Chery Omoda E5 7.2 seconds; Suzuki Swift Sport 8.0 seconds.
  • Range/economy: Chery Omoda E5 430 km WLTP from a 61 kWh battery; Suzuki Swift Sport 6.1 L/100 km from a 37-litre tank.
  • Boot space: Chery Omoda E5 378 litres; Suzuki Swift Sport 265 litres.
  • Top speed: Chery Omoda E5 172 km/h; Suzuki Swift Sport 205 km/h.

Omoda E5

  • 430 km WLTP range from a 61 kWh battery.
  • 378-litre boot and 2,630 mm wheelbase.
  • Blind spot information, autonomous braking and lane-keeping assist.
  • RM15,900 more expensive.
  • 172 km/h top speed versus 205 km/h.
  • Tyre repair kit instead of a space-saver spare.

Swift Sport

  • RM15,900 lower purchase price and RM70 annual road tax.
  • 205 km/h top speed with a six-speed automatic and paddle shifts.
  • Compact 3,890 mm length and 970 kg weight.
  • 265-litre boot versus 378 litres.
  • 8.0-second 0-100 km/h time versus 7.2 seconds.
  • No blind spot information, autonomous braking or lane-keeping assist.

Omoda E5 vs Swift Sport FAQ

Is the Chery Omoda E5 or Suzuki Swift Sport better?

The Omoda E5 is better for range, space, acceleration and active safety, provided charging is convenient. The Swift Sport suits buyers prioritising lower purchase cost, lower road tax, compact dimensions and its 205 km/h top speed.

What is the price difference?

The Chery Omoda E5 costs RM146,800 and the Suzuki Swift Sport costs RM130,900, so the Omoda E5 is RM15,900 dearer.

Which has more luggage space?

The Chery Omoda E5 has the larger boot at 378 litres, 113 litres more than the Suzuki Swift Sport’s 265 litres.
